International Tower Hill Mines Ltd. Business Introduction

International Tower Hill Mines Ltd. (ITH) is a mineral exploration and development company focused on the acquisition, exploration, and development of gold projects. The company is primarily defined by its 100% interest in the Livengood Gold Project, located in Alaska, USA. Unlike diversified mining conglomerates, ITH operates as a "pure-play" asset developer, concentrating its resources on bringing one of North America's largest undeveloped gold deposits toward production.

Business Module Details

1. The Livengood Gold Project: This is the company's sole and flagship asset. Located approximately 70 miles north of Fairbanks, Alaska, it covers approximately 19,500 hectares. As of the 2021 Pre-Feasibility Study (PFS), the project hosts a Measured and Indicated Mineral Resource of 13.6 million ounces of gold at a grade of 0.60 g/t. This massive scale places it among the top tier of gold optionality plays in stable jurisdictions.

2. Resource Optimization and Engineering: The company focuses on technical de-risking. This includes metallurgical testing to improve recovery rates and environmental baseline studies required for the permitting process. ITH is currently in a "holding and optimization" phase, waiting for favorable gold price environments to trigger large-scale construction.

3. Asset Maintenance and Permitting: A significant portion of the business involves maintaining the project in "good standing." This includes paying claim fees, engaging with local Alaskan stakeholders, and ensuring environmental compliance to preserve the long-term value of the mineral rights.

Business Model Characteristics

Gold Optionality Play: ITH represents a "leveraged bet" on the price of gold. Because the project is large but carries relatively lower grades, its economic viability is highly sensitive to gold price fluctuations. When gold prices rise, the Net Present Value (NPV) of Livengood increases disproportionately compared to smaller, high-grade mines.

Capital Asset Strategy: The company follows a "Lean Management" model. It maintains a small corporate team to minimize G&A (General and Administrative) expenses, preserving cash while waiting for the right market conditions or a potential acquisition by a major gold producer.

Core Competitive Moat

· Location and Jurisdiction: Alaska is consistently ranked as one of the top mining jurisdictions globally by the Fraser Institute. Unlike projects in politically unstable regions, Livengood benefits from established U.S. property laws and proximity to the Trans-Alaska Pipeline System corridor and paved highways.

· Massive Scale: With over 13 million ounces in resources, the project offers a scale that is rare in the gold industry. Most major gold producers (Tier 1 miners) require deposits of this size to replace their depleting reserves, making ITH a prime M&A target.

· Significant Infrastructure: The project is adjacent to the Elliott Highway and has access to the regional power grid, significantly lowering the initial capital expenditure (CAPEX) compared to "remote" projects that require building hundreds of miles of new roads or power plants.

Latest Strategic Layout

According to the 2024 corporate updates, the company’s strategy is focused on "Value Preservation and Readiness." Specifically, ITH is refining the project’s processing flowsheet to reduce energy consumption and exploring "Phase 1" smaller-scale startup options to lower the initial billion-dollar CAPEX requirement identified in earlier studies.

International Tower Hill Mines Ltd. Development History

The history of International Tower Hill Mines is a saga of discovery and patient endurance within the cyclical mining industry. Its journey can be divided into three distinct eras.

First Phase: Discovery and Rapid Growth (2006 - 2011)

International Tower Hill Mines was incorporated in 1991, but its modern history began in 2006 when it acquired the Livengood property. Following the discovery of the Money Knob deposit, the company underwent an aggressive drilling campaign. By 2010-2011, as gold prices approached then-record highs of $1,900/oz, ITH became a market darling, with its stock price soaring as the resource estimate grew from 2 million to over 10 million ounces.

Second Phase: Technical Realism and Market Downturn (2012 - 2019)

Following the peak in gold prices, the company transitioned from exploration to engineering. In 2013, a Feasibility Study revealed that the project required significant capital—over $2.7 billion—to build, which was difficult to raise during a period of declining gold prices. This led to a strategic pivot: the company shifted toward cost reduction and technical optimization, significantly reducing its workforce and overhead to survive the "bear market" in precious metals.

Third Phase: Strategic Optimization (2020 - Present)

With the resurgence of gold prices in the 2020s, ITH updated its Pre-Feasibility Study in late 2021. This update incorporated modern mining techniques and updated cost estimates. The company has successfully raised capital through private placements (notably supported by major shareholders like Paulson & Co.) to ensure it remains debt-free while advancing environmental baseline work.

Success and Challenges Analysis

Success Factors: The company’s survival is largely due to its strong institutional backing (e.g., John Paulson) and its strict fiscal discipline. By not rushing into an uneconomic build during the 2014-2018 period, they avoided bankruptcy that claimed many of their peers.

Unfavorable Factors: The primary challenge has been the high CAPEX/low grade nature of the deposit. In a low gold price environment ($1,200 - $1,500), the project’s Internal Rate of Return (IRR) was marginal, leading to years of sideways movement in the share price.

Industry Introduction

International Tower Hill Mines operates in the Gold Mining and Exploration Industry. This sector is characterized by high capital intensity, long lead times from discovery to production (often 15-20 years), and extreme sensitivity to macroeconomic factors including inflation, interest rates, and geopolitical stability.

Industry Trends and Catalysts

1. Depleting Global Reserves: Major miners (Barrick, Newmont) are struggling to replace the ounces they mine each year. This creates a "supply gap" that makes large, proven North American deposits like Livengood increasingly valuable.

2. Safe Haven Demand: As of Q1 2024, central bank gold buying has reached record levels. Persistent global inflation and debt concerns act as a long-term tailwind for gold prices, which directly impacts ITH’s project economics.

3. ESG and Permitting: There is a growing trend toward "Responsible Mining." Projects in Tier 1 jurisdictions (USA, Canada, Australia) command a premium because they are perceived to have lower "expropriation risk" compared to projects in emerging markets.

Competitive Landscape

The industry is divided into three tiers:
· Tier 1 (Majors): Newmont, Barrick Gold. They are the potential buyers of ITH.
· Tier 2 (Mid-Tiers): Agnico Eagle, Kinross Gold. Kinross notably operates the Fort Knox mine nearby, making them a logical strategic partner for ITH.
· Tier 3 (Juniors/Explorers): Companies like ITH, Seabridge Gold, and Northern Dynasty Minerals.

Comparative Data: Top Undeveloped Gold Deposits in North America

Project Name Owner Resource (M oz) Jurisdiction
Donlin Gold Barrick / NOVAGOLD ~39.0 Alaska, USA
KSM Project Seabridge Gold ~47.0 BC, Canada
Livengood International Tower Hill ~13.6 Alaska, USA
Pebble Project Northern Dynasty ~70.0 Alaska, USA

*Data based on 2021-2023 public filings and NI 43-101 reports.

Industry Position and Characteristics

ITH occupies a unique "niche" as a Tier 1 Asset in a Tier 1 Jurisdiction. While its grade is lower than some peers, its lack of environmental controversy (compared to the Pebble Project) and its superior infrastructure (compared to Donlin Gold) make it one of the most "de-risked" large-scale gold options available in the market today. Its valuation is essentially a "call option" on gold; it underperforms in stagnant markets but historically outperforms the gold price during bull runs.

International Tower Hill Mines Ltd. Development Potential

Strategic Roadmap & Milestone Progress

ITH is transitioning from a holding phase to an active development phase. Following the successful capital raise of approximately $118 million USD in January 2026, the company has updated its roadmap for the Livengood Gold Project:

  • Feasibility Study (FS): Approximately $50 million of the new funding is allocated to advanced technical and feasibility studies. This is a critical step to de-risk the project for a final investment decision.
  • Permitting and Environment: $35 million is designated for major permitting work and baseline environmental data collection, focusing on hydrology and waste rock characterization.
  • Antimony Opportunity: A new catalyst is the exploration of antimony recovery. Antimony is classified as a "critical mineral." Preliminary metallurgical tests in 2025 showed encouraging results from stibnite veins, potentially adding a high-value byproduct to the gold production.

Asset Quality and Valuation Catalyst

The Livengood Project is one of the largest undeveloped gold deposits in North America. According to the 2023 Technical Report Summary, it holds 9.0 million ounces of proven and probable reserves at an average grade of 0.65 g/t. At current gold prices (which have remained significantly higher than the $1,680/oz base case used in earlier studies), the Net Present Value (NPV) of the project increases exponentially. For example, at $2,500/oz gold, the after-tax NPV is estimated at $2.35 billion.


International Tower Hill Mines Ltd. Pros and Risks

Investment Pros (Opportunities)

1. Massive Scale and Leverage: With 9 million ounces of reserves, ITH provides significant leverage to the price of gold. Small increases in gold prices lead to disproportionately large increases in the project's projected value.
2. Institutional Backing: Hedge fund Paulson & Co. recently increased its stake to 35%, demonstrating strong conviction from professional investors and providing the capital needed to survive long permitting cycles.
3. Infrastructure Advantage: Unlike many remote Alaskan projects, Livengood is located 70 miles north of Fairbanks and is adjacent to a major highway and utility corridor, significantly reducing potential capital expenditures for infrastructure.
4. Critical Minerals Upside: The potential to produce antimony could qualify the company for strategic government incentives or grants related to critical mineral security.

Investment Risks

1. High Capital Expenditure (CAPEX): The 2023 TRS estimated initial capital costs at $1.93 billion. Raising such a large sum for construction is a massive hurdle for a junior miner.
2. Permitting Uncertainty: Alaska is a stable jurisdiction but has rigorous environmental standards. The permitting process can take many years, and any delays could lead to further share dilution if additional working capital is needed.
3. Market Volatility: As a development-stage company, ITH’s stock price is highly sensitive to fluctuations in gold prices and general sentiment toward speculative mining stocks.

How Do Analysts View International Tower Hill Mines Ltd. and ITH Stock?

As of early 2024 and moving into the mid-year period, analyst sentiment regarding International Tower Hill Mines Ltd. (ITH) remains characterized as "speculative but fundamentally anchored by asset scale." As the company continues to advance its flagship Livengood Gold Project in Alaska, the investment community views ITH less as an active gold producer and more as a high-leverage play on long-term gold prices.

The following sections detail the core perspectives from market analysts and institutional observers:

1. Institutional Core Perspectives on the Company

Massive Resource Scale: Analysts consistently highlight that ITH controls one of the largest undeveloped gold assets in North America. According to the 2022 Pre-Feasibility Study (PFS) update, the Livengood project hosts 13.6 million ounces of gold in the Measured and Indicated categories. BMO Capital Markets and other resource-focused desks view this as a "strategic reserve" that becomes increasingly attractive as global gold prices sustain levels above $2,000 per ounce.

Option Value Asset: Many analysts categorize ITH as a "Gold Optionality" stock. This means the company’s valuation is highly sensitive to the spot price of gold because the project’s high capital expenditure (CAPEX) requirements make it a marginal asset. When gold prices surge, the Net Present Value (NPV) of Livengood increases exponentially, often leading to outsized gains in the stock price compared to established producers.

Strong Institutional Backing: Analysts point to the high level of institutional ownership as a sign of long-term stability. Major shareholders such as Paulson & Co., Sprott Asset Management, and Kopernik Global Investors hold significant stakes, suggesting that sophisticated investors are willing to wait for a favorable gold cycle or a potential acquisition by a major miner.

2. Stock Ratings and Valuation

Due to its status as a development-stage company with no current revenue, ITH is primarily covered by specialist mining analysts rather than generalist retail firms.

Rating Consensus: The prevailing consensus is a "Speculative Buy" or "Hold" depending on an investor's risk tolerance for pre-production mining.

Key Valuation Metrics (2024 Context):
Price-to-Book (P/B) Ratio: ITH often trades at a discount to its peer group (other North American developers), which some analysts interpret as an undervalued entry point, while others see it as a reflection of the project's high development hurdles.
Market Cap per Ounce: Analysts frequently calculate the company's valuation based on "dollars per ounce in the ground." Currently, ITH trades at a significantly lower valuation per ounce than companies with smaller but more "permitted" or "higher-grade" deposits, indicating a high risk-reward profile.

3. Analyst-Identified Risks (The Bear Case)

Despite the massive resource, analysts urge caution regarding several critical factors:

High Capital Intensity: The initial CAPEX required to bring Livengood into production is estimated at roughly $1.93 billion. Analysts note that for a junior company with a modest market capitalization, securing this level of financing without massive shareholder dilution is a significant challenge.

Lower Grade Profile: The average grade of the deposit is approximately 0.60 g/t gold. In a high-inflation environment where labor, energy, and equipment costs are rising, analysts worry that the "all-in sustaining cost" (AISC) might remain too high to justify development unless gold stays consistently above $2,300–$2,500.

Permitting and Timeline: While Alaska is generally considered a mining-friendly jurisdiction, the large-scale nature of the project necessitates rigorous environmental reviews and federal permits. Analysts warn that the road to "first gold" is still many years away, making the stock susceptible to "dead money" periods if gold prices trade sideways.

Summary

The Wall Street consensus on International Tower Hill Mines is that it serves as a leveraged bet on the gold macro-environment. Analysts believe that while the company lacks the immediate cash flow of a producer, its 13.6-million-ounce resource makes it a primary candidate for a buyout by a "Major" (like Barrick or Newmont) if the gold bull market accelerates. For now, it remains a high-beta vehicle for investors looking for maximum exposure to gold price appreciation in a stable Tier-1 jurisdiction.

Is the current valuation of ITH (THM) stock high? How do its P/E and P/B ratios compare to the industry?

Standard valuation metrics like the Price-to-Earnings (P/E) ratio are not applicable to ITH because the company has no earnings. Investors typically value the company based on its Enterprise Value per Ounce (EV/oz) of gold in the ground.
Historically, ITH trades at a significant discount to its peers on an EV/oz basis because the Livengood project requires a high gold price environment to be economically viable (the 2021 PFS used a $1,680/oz gold price base case). As of mid-2024, the Price-to-Book (P/B) ratio stands around 0.6x to 0.8x, which is relatively low for the industry, reflecting the market's cautious stance on the timing of the project's development.

How has the ITH stock price performed over the past three months and year compared to its peers?

Over the past year, ITH's stock price has shown significant volatility, often tracking the spot price of gold. While the broader gold mining sector (represented by the GDXJ ETF) saw gains in early 2024, ITH has occasionally lagged behind producers because it lacks immediate cash flow.
Over the last 12 months, the stock has traded in a range between $0.40 and $0.75. Compared to peers like Novagold, ITH tends to outperform during sharp gold rallies but underperforms during periods of gold price consolidation due to its higher "optionality" profile and lower liquidity.

Are there any recent industry tailwinds or headwinds affecting ITH?

The primary tailwind for ITH is the sustained high price of gold, which moved above $2,300/oz in 2024. Higher gold prices significantly improve the Net Present Value (NPV) of the Livengood project. Additionally, the U.S. government's focus on securing domestic mineral supply chains is a positive macro factor for Alaskan projects.
The main headwinds include inflationary pressures on capital expenditures (CAPEX) for mine construction and high interest rates, which increase the cost of capital for large-scale infrastructure projects. Furthermore, the permitting environment in the United States remains a complex and lengthy process for large-scale mining operations.
